Why is regular maintenance important for HVAC systems?

Routine maintenance is essential for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ems to ensure peak performance, extend equipment life, and avert unplanned malfunctions. By making sure the equipment is properly maintained, these advantages can be realized.

The following factors make maintaining HVAC systems in excellent operating order crucial:

An increase in the effectiveness of energy use
Regular maintenance on the heating, ventilation, and air conditioning system is necessary to ensure that it is functioning at its best. Filters, coils, and other parts should be cleaned and replaced as part of this maintenance.
Monthly power bills are lower when a system is kept up to date since it consumes less energy. This can be attributed to the improved state of the system. Unclean or clogged components force the system to work harder, increasing the amount of energy used. Increasing the system's efficiency is essential.

An Extended Period of Use for the Equipment
By lowering the amount of wear and tear that the system endures over time, routine maintenance of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ems helps to increase their lifespan.
It is feasible to stop small flaws from growing into more serious issues that may eventually require expensive repairs or replacements by addressing them early on through routine maintenance. By fixing minor flaws early on, this can be achieved.

A decreased probability of encountering failures
Frequent inspections provide professionals the chance to spot possible problems, which helps them prevent system failures. This preventive approach reduces the possibility of unexpected malfunctions, which is particularly helpful during busy times of the year when the system is being heavily used.
This can be achieved by performing regular maintenance and inspections, which lowers the likelihood that urgent repairs will be necessary by ensuring that all components are operating as intended.

An enhancement in the indoor air quality that is exhaled
By making sure the coils, ducts, and air filters are clean, routine maintenance helps to improve the building's air quality. The air quality has improved overall as a result of this. Maintaining clean components is essential to preventing the transmission of dust, allergies, mold, and other contaminants throughout the structure.
Making sure that a building's occupants are happy and healthy is crucial, especially in settings like workplaces, schools, and medical facilities. This is particularly true when considering the conditions under which the structure is occupied.

High comfort levels that are consistently present
Regular heating, cooling, and humidity control can be achieved with a well-maintained he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) system. This contributes to ensuring a comfortable indoor environment all year long.
Regular maintenance to the system may allow it to respond to temperature changes more quickly. This makes it possible to guarantee that the optimal degree of comfort is consistently maintained.

Savings and cost reductions
Preventive maintenance can help lower the need for costly repairs, which can save money by preventing expensive emergency call-outs. Costs can be reduced by doing preventive maintenance.
In the long term, maintenance is a more economical option since it keeps efficiency high, which lowers energy expenses. Efficiency is preserved when maintenance is carried out often.

Noncompliance with the warranty's mandatory terms and conditions
The obligation for routine maintenance is a component of many HVAC system manufacturers' warranty terms. By adhering to a set maintenance schedule, compliance is guaranteed, safeguarding both the warranty and the investment.
Should repairs or replacements be necessary, this might lead to the warranty being revoked and expensive repairs or replacements. The warranty may also be revoked for neglecting maintenance.

Beneficial effects on the environment

An effective heating, ventilation, and air conditioning system uses less energy, which lowers the carbon footprint the system creates. Performing routine system maintenance helps to guarantee that energy is not wasted, which in turn leads to more ecologically responsible activities.
Additionally, properly maintained systems generate fewer emissions, which helps to maintain the atmosphere's environmental friendliness.
